Captain Glynn Griffiths on the bridge on board the 3-masted topsail schooner Sir Winston Churchill (1966) while under sail at Spithead. He is talking to one of his officers. A girl trainee is at the helm being supervised by the Foremast Watch Leader. The photographer is looking forward and to starboard from the port side of the aft deck.
